#69cad2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#69cad2 is composed of 41.2% red, 79.2%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50% cyan, 3.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 184.6 degrees, a saturation of 53.8% and a lightness of 61.8%. #69cad2 color hex could be obtained by blending #d2ffff with #0095a5.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#69cad2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1fafb is the lightest one.
